Former Governor Kiraitu Murungi Admits Plotting Kawira Mwangaza’s Impeachment

Former Meru Governor Kiraitu Murungi has admitted to being part of a group of Meru leaders that planned the impeachment of former Meru Governor Kawira Mwangaza.

According to Murungi, Mwangaza was fighting other Meru leaders including Members of the County Assembly and Members of Parliament.

“She was at war with all MPs, MCAs, and even those of us who were there before her, she went around everywhere insulting and embarrassing us. She was very arrogant. Now that she is gone, that’s why you see happiness in Meru,” said Murungi.

He moreover noted that Mwangaza pledged to uplift the people of Meru however she did not fulfil the promise in the two years she was the county boss.

“We realized that even if she is given ten years, Meru would continue to lag behind and remain stuck in the mud. As concerned Meru leaders, we saw it fit to help our people get out of this political mess. So, we united with other leaders, did what we could, and now she is at home,” Murungi added.

Murungi’s confession came after Mwangaza claimed that she was removed from office because she refused to be politically manipulated.

Mwangaza said that her impeachment was orchestrated by national government officials and her political competitors.

On Friday, March 14, High Court Judge Justice Bahati Mwamuye upheld the Senate’s decision to impeach Mwangaza, stating that her petition to block her removal from office did not meet the required threshold to overturn the impeachment.

After the ruling, Isaac Mutuma was sworn in as the new Meru Governor in an event held at Mwendantu Grounds in Meru County.
